Sympetrum illotum (Cardinal Meadowhawk), Males perch low over or adjacent to still or slow-moving water at ponds, canals, and small open streams. The eyes are red to go with an orange-red face, and they often perch expectantly, wings bowed forward, ready to launch at any moment.
